TICKET: Blue-green deploys for billing worker

The Quartzbill worker currently deploys in-place, causing ~90s of dropped invoice jobs per release. Proposal: switch to blue-green via the Lanternset orchestrator. Green pool drains queue consumers before cutover; rollback is a pointer flip. Support impact: no more "stuck invoice" tickets during release windows. Staging validation done on Tuesday's run, zero job loss across three cutovers. Needs sign-off before Friday's release train. The sign-off owner is listed below.

named custodian: Ulador Kasath Zoreth

**Q: A surveyor's tablet went offline mid-survey in TrailMark — are their plots lost?**

Nope, probably not. TrailMark's offline mode caches everything locally and syncs once it sees a connection again. Have them open the app, tap the cloud icon, and wait for the spinner to finish. If the cache itself got encrypted after a forced logout (happens after 14 days offline), they'll need to unlock it manually. Walk them through Settings → Offline Vault, then read them the passphrase below.

unlock words, hahip-yagef: zorok-novmir-zorix-silax

Handover from the Larkspur dispatch team: the driver-assignment heuristic weights proximity 60%, shift remaining 25%, vehicle fit 15%. If support sees clustered late pickups, the proximity index has likely gone stale — rerun the refresh job rather than reassigning manually. The refresh console requires elevated access; authenticate with the recovery passphrase noted on the line below.

unlock words, hahip-baduf: holwyn-istath-julvan

## Runbook: SeatGrid Renderer (Velvet Curtain Theatre)

SeatGrid renders hall layouts server-side; no client writes. If renders fail, check the layout cache first, then the upstream plan service. Renderer runs unprivileged in its own namespace. All admin endpoints require mTLS plus a service key. Logs omit patron data by design. To exercise the render endpoint manually during triage, authenticate with the key below.

service key, fawip-bajef: kto11_Qt5wZK9vdNC